СДЕЛАЙТЕ СВОИ УРОКИ ЕЩЁ ЭФФЕКТИВНЕЕ, А ЖИЗНЬ СВОБОДНЕЕ

Благодаря готовым учебным материалам для работы в классе и дистанционно

Скидки до 50 % на комплекты
только до

Готовые ключевые этапы урока всегда будут у вас под рукой

Организационный момент

Проверка знаний

Объяснение материала

Закрепление изученного

Итоги урока

Объектно-ориентированное программирование в Delphi

Внимание! Все тесты в этом разделе разработаны пользователями сайта для собственного использования. Администрация сайта не проверяет возможные ошибки, которые могут встретиться в тестах.
1-модуль. Экзамен

Список вопросов теста

Вопрос 1

Delphi – это

Варианты ответов
  • язык программирования высокого уровня, в основе которого лежит язык Pascal;
  • среда быстрой разработки, в которой в качестве языка программирования используется язык Visual Basic;
  • среда быстрой разработки, в которой в качестве языка программирования используется язык Delphi.
Вопрос 2

Окна Delphi:

Варианты ответов
  • кно стартовой формы, окно редактора свойств объектов, окно просмотра списка объектов, окно редактора кода, главное окно;
  • окно стартовой формы, окно редактора списка объектов, окно просмотра свойств объектов, окно редактора кода, главное окно;
  • окно стартовой формы, окно редактора свойств объектов, окно просмотра списка объектов, окно редактора кода, главное меню.
Вопрос 3

Поле редактирования – …

Варианты ответов
  • Label;
  • Caption;
  • Edit.
Вопрос 4

Задача: «Вычислить сумму первых N натуральных чисел». Выберите верную процедуру для решения этой задачи (на нумерацию компонентов не обращать внимания):


 

Варианты ответов
  • procedure TForm1.Button1Click(Sender: TObject); var N, s, i : integer; begin writeln (‘Введите N’); readln(N); S:=0; For i:=1 to N do s:=s+i; Writeln(‘Сумма первых ’, N, ‘ чисел равна ’, s); end;
  • procedure TForm1.Button1Click(Sender: TObject); var N, s, i : integer; begin N := StrToInt(Edit1.Text); S:=0; For i:=1 to N do s:=s+i; Label2.Text := ‘Сумма равна ’+ IntToStr(s); end;
  • procedure TForm1.Button1Click(Sender: TObject); var N, s, i : integer; begin N := StrToInt(Edit1.Text); S:=0; For i:=1 to N do s:=s+i; Label2.Caption := ‘Результат’+ IntToStr(s);
Вопрос 5

Язык Delphi —

Варианты ответов
  • строго типизированный объектно-ориентированный язык, в основе которого лежит язык Pascal;
  • строго типизированный объектно-ориентированный язык, в основе которого лежит язык Object Pascal;
  • строго типизированный объектно-ориентированный язык, в основе которого лежит язык Visual Basic.
Вопрос 6

Каким типом определяется вещественное число:
 

Варианты ответов
  • String
  • Real
  • Integer
Вопрос 7

 Что такое переменная:
 

Варианты ответов
  • перезаписываемый сектор жесткого диска
  • свойство компонента, которое можно изменять
  • ячейка оперативной памяти, в которой могут храниться данные какого-то типа
Вопрос 8

 Что такое объект:
 

Варианты ответов
  • совокупность методов, свойств и событий
  • переменная, которая влияет на состояние объекта
  • совокупность процедур и функций, указывающих на возможности объекта
Вопрос 9

Что такое метод объекта:
 

Варианты ответов
  • процедура, которая выполняется, если произошло какое-то событие
  • процедура, которая имеет доступ к свойствам объекта и обеспечивает его работу
  • функция, которая выполняется, если произошло какое-то событие
Вопрос 10

В каком разделе объявляют константы:
 

Варианты ответов
  • var
  • type
  • const
Вопрос 11

В каком разделе объявляется массив:
 

Варианты ответов
  • var
  • array
  • massive
Вопрос 12

Укажите свойство компонента Edit, которое отвечает за текст, который пользователь ввел в поле ввода:
 

Варианты ответов
  • label
  • name
  • text
Вопрос 13

К какому типу относится свойство Caption
 

Варианты ответов
  • Простое
  • Перечисляемое
  • Вложенное
Вопрос 14

Элемент Button находится на вкладке:

Варианты ответов
  • Additional;
  • Standard;
  • Win32.
Вопрос 15

Метод это:

Варианты ответов
  • Функция, получая в качестве обязательного параметра указатель на объект
  • Структура, хранящая указатели this, parrent, supper
  • Структурная переменная, содержащая всю информацию о некотором физическом предмете или реализуемом в программе понятии
Вопрос 16

Класс это:

Варианты ответов
  • Структурная переменная, содержащая всю информацию о некотором физическом предмете или реализуемом в программе понятии
  • Определенный программистом абстрактный тип данных
  • Переменная, описанная абстрактным типом данных
Вопрос 17

 Как называются элементы класса которые относяться ко всем экземплярам объектов класса

Варианты ответов
  • Статические
  • Динамические
  • Константные
Вопрос 18

Один из принципов объектно-ориентированного программирования:

Варианты ответов
  • Инкапсуляция
  • Ингаляция
  • Инструкция
Вопрос 19

Все объекты в Delphi происходят от объекта:

Варианты ответов
  • МObject
  • TObject
  • ВObject
Вопрос 20

Свойство Caption отвечает за:

Варианты ответов
  • Назначение компонента на форме
  • Название компонента на форме
  • Вид компонента на форме
Сохранить у себя: